104026881 has 32 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 170956800. Its totient is φ = 54933120.
The previous prime is 104026877. The next prime is 104026931. The reversal of 104026881 is 188620401.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 104026881 - 22 = 104026877 is a prime.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×1040268812 = 21643183941176322, which contains 22 as substring.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(104026841)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(11)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 31 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 13180 + ... + 19538.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(5342400).
Almost surely, 2104026881 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
104026881 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(66929919).
104026881 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
104026881 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 6429.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 3072, while the sum is 30.
The square root of 104026881 is about 10199.3568914908. The cubic root of 104026881 is about 470.3074508665.
The spelling of 104026881 in words is "one hundred four million, twenty-six thousand, eight hundred eighty-one".
